Transaction 07e632856be94aadb6eaa9933fe4e89920e0d2b0690dac254940d68c2c99d831
1 Input
2 Outputs
- 07e632856be94aadb6eaa9933fe4e89920e0d2b0690dac254940d68c2c99d831:0
- 07e632856be94aadb6eaa9933fe4e89920e0d2b0690dac254940d68c2c99d831:1
value 10000000
address 1ANk2ak5XPxP2NaMAczmu8S9gM25V2fboo
value 182907004
address 16FPot4jjkYsm1T8JaVJz3ShdbKzSz5kvL